Banner Health is seeking a Health Unit Coordinator for the Behavioral Medical Surgical team at Banner Thunderbird Medical Center. This position is responsible for a variety of administrative support functions and customer service for an assigned patient care area, promoting an organized and efficient delivery of care. The role facilitates communication between physicians and nurses, handles consult calls, and acts as a liaison with internal departments and external contacts. The Health Unit Coordinator may float between Med-Surg and Med-Surg overflow units, including General, Behavioral, Ortho, Trauma, and Oncology. Banner Thunderbird Medical Center has served the Northwest Valley for over 25 years and is a Level 1 Trauma Center with a heart and vascular center, state-of-the-art surgical suites, and a new Emergency department.
